The screen will display an "Initialization in Progress" message. Do not turn off the machine during this process, as it can corrupt the firmware.

For a complete restoration, it is common to select "System Memory Clear" and "User Memory Clear." This action targets the hard drive partitions that store the operating system settings and user preferences. When the execute button is pressed, the machine will prompt for confirmation. Once confirmed, the C258 will begin the process, which may take several minutes. During this time, the screen may flicker or display progress bars; it is imperative that the machine is not powered down during this cycle, as doing so can corrupt the firmware and brick the device. konica minolta bizhub c258 factory reset

To perform a factory reset on a Konica Minolta bizhub C258 , you must access the (also known as Tech Rep mode) to initialize the system data . This process clears all user settings and configurations without affecting the physical meter readings. 1. Access Service Mode On the control panel, press the Utility button. Tap Counter on the screen. Tap Display Keypad to bring up the on-screen number pad.
